电子科技大学21秋《微机原理及应用》平时作业一参考答案40

上传人:汽*** 文档编号:498906813 上传时间:2023-11-25 格式:DOCX 页数:14 大小:15.77KB
返回 下载 相关 举报
电子科技大学21秋《微机原理及应用》平时作业一参考答案40_第1页
第1页 / 共14页
电子科技大学21秋《微机原理及应用》平时作业一参考答案40_第2页
第2页 / 共14页
电子科技大学21秋《微机原理及应用》平时作业一参考答案40_第3页
第3页 / 共14页
电子科技大学21秋《微机原理及应用》平时作业一参考答案40_第4页
第4页 / 共14页
电子科技大学21秋《微机原理及应用》平时作业一参考答案40_第5页
第5页 / 共14页
点击查看更多>>
资源描述

《电子科技大学21秋《微机原理及应用》平时作业一参考答案40》由会员分享,可在线阅读,更多相关《电子科技大学21秋《微机原理及应用》平时作业一参考答案40(14页珍藏版)》请在金锄头文库上搜索。

1、电子科技大学21秋微机原理及应用平时作业一参考答案1. 8086和8088CPU的内部都采用16位字进行操作及存储器寻址,两者的软件完全兼容,程序的执行也完全相同。( )A.错误B.正确参考答案:B2. 8086指令系统提供了对8位数和16位数的逻辑操作指令。这些指令分为两类:一类是逻辑运算指令另一类是移位指令。( )A.错误B.正确参考答案:B3. 动态随机存储器需要不断地刷新,其目的是防止存储单元中记忆的信息丢失。( )动态随机存储器需要不断地刷新,其目的是防止存储单元中记忆的信息丢失。()正确4. 存取周期是指( )。A.存储器的写入时间B.存储器的读出时间C.存储器进行连续写操作允许的

2、最短时间间隔D.存储器进行连续读/写操作允许的最短时间3间隔参考答案:D5. 自然连接是自身连接的一种特殊情况,把目标列中重复的属性列去掉。( )此题为判断题(对,错)。正确答案:错误6. 1-3布尔代数的特点是( )A.其中的变量A,B,C,D等均只有两种可能的数值:0或1B.变量的数值并无大小之意,只代表事物的两个不同性质C.函数f只有3种基本方式:“或”运算,“与”运算及“反”运算D.布尔代数也有交换律、结合律、分配律参考答案:ABCD7. 8086CPU响应NMI或INTR中断时,相同的条件是( )。A、CPU工作在最大方式下B、CPU工作在最小方式下C、当前指令执行结束D、IF=1参

3、考答案:C8. FrontPage中构成网页最基本的两种元素,一个是文字,另一个是_。FrontPage中构成网页最基本的两种元素,一个是文字,另一个是_。正确答案:图片图片9. 8086的存储器是分段的,定义一个段的伪指令是( )。A.PROC和ENDPB.NAME和ENDC.SEGMENT和ENDSD.SEGMENT和ASSUME参考答案:C10. 用来表示堆栈指针的寄存器是( )。A、IPB、BPC、SSD、SP参考答案:D11. 当简单外部设备作为输出设备时,一般都需要( )A.数据总线B.接口C.锁存器D.显示器参考答案:C12. 关系中的选择运算是选择出满足条件的行构成新的行。(

4、)此题为判断题(对,错)。正确答案:错误13. 下列程序的功能是:单击窗体时将随机生成10个099之间的随机数,并赋值给数组A,然后利用选择法排序下列程序的功能是:单击窗体时将随机生成10个099之间的随机数,并赋值给数组A,然后利用选择法排序;并把排序后的结果输出。 Private Sub Form_Click( ) Dim A(9) As Integer,i As Integer Dim j As Integer,k As Integer Randomize For i=0 To 9 A(i)=Int(100*Rnd) Next i For i=0 To 8 k=【 】 For j=i T

5、o 9 If(A(k)A(j)Then 【 】 End If Next j If ki Then t=A(k):A(k)=A(i):A(i)=t End If Next i For i=0 To 9 Print A(i), Next i Print End Sub正确答案:i k=j选择排序法是一种简单的排序方法,其方法步骤可描述如下:设有N个元素要从小到大排列,选择法排序过程可分为N-1轮:第一轮:从第1N个数中找出最小的数和第一个数交换,第一个数排好。第二轮:从第2N个数中找出最小的数和第二个数交换,第二个数排好。第i轮:从第iN个数中找出最小的数和第i个数交换,第i个数排好。第N-1轮:

6、从第N-1N个数中找出最小的数与第N-1个数交换,排序结束。本题中变量k用来记下每一轮的最小值的下标,首先认为最小值为该轮的第一个元素a(i),它的下标是i,因此9处应用“i”。最小的数要和后面的每一个元素比较,如果后面的元素小,则记下它的下标,故在10处应用k记下较小的元素下标,应填“k=j”。14. 多处理机的Cache一致性问题是指_。多处理机的Cache一致性问题是指_。正确答案:不同处理机的Cache中同一地址的数据块可能不一致Cache与共享主存中同一地址的数据块也可能不一致不同处理机的Cache中同一地址的数据块可能不一致,Cache与共享主存中同一地址的数据块也可能不一致15.

7、 在8086微机系统的RAM存储单元器0000H002CH开始依次存放23H,0FFH,00H,和0F0H四个字节,该向量对应的中断号是( )。A.0AHB.0BHC.0CHD.0DH参考答案:B16. 在Java语言中,byte类型的数据能表示的数据范围是【 】。在Java语言中,byte类型的数据能表示的数据范围是【 】。正确答案:-128127由于byte类型数据占计算机存储的8位,并且是有符号整型,第1位用于表示符号,剩下还有7位用做存储数据,因此正整数最大应该是27_1=127,而负整数最小应该是-2(上标)7;-128,这样总共表示的数的个数应该是2(上标)8-1=255个。17.

8、 PC/XT微机中串口1的I/O地址范围是( )。A.3F0H-3F7HB.3F8H-3FFC.2F0H-2FFHD.2F8H-2FF参考答案:B18. 中断向量表是存放( )的存储区域。中断向量表是存放( )的存储区域。A、中断类型号B、中断服务程序入口处地址C、中断断点地址D、程序状态字正确答案:B19. DAC0832由( )组成A.8位输入锁存器B.8位输出锁存器C.8位DAC寄存器D.8位D/A转换电路参考答案:ACD20. 下面有语法错误的指令是( )。A.MOV AX,BXSIB.MOV AX,-2BXDIC.MOV AX,BXBPD.MOV AX,-1BXSI参考答案:C21.

9、 根据对DAC0832的输入锁存器和DAC寄存器的不同的控制方法,DAC0832有4种工作方式。( )A.错误B.正确参考答案:A22. 实现A/D转换的方法很多,常用的有哪些方法( )A.时序信号法B.逐次逼近法C.双积分法D.电压频率转换法参考答案:BCD23. VAR是数据段中定义的字变量,指令MOV AX,VAR+2是正确的。( )A、正确B、错误参考答案:A24. CPU可以访问串行接口中的( )个主要寄存器。从原则上说,对这些寄存器可以通过不同的地址来访问A.1B.2C.3D.4参考答案:D25. 在BIOS键盘驱动程序的解释下,IBM-PC的键盘除了提供有通常的输入ASCII字符

10、外,它还具有如下功能( )A.直接向系统输入某字符的编码B.功能键C.光标控制与编辑键D.专用功能的实现参考答案:ABCD26. 用非线性误差的大小表示D/A转换的线性度。( )A.错误B.正确参考答案:B27. 补码只有二进制数才有。( )A.错误B.正确参考答案:A28. R0M中的信息是( )。A由计算机制造厂预先写入的B在系统安装时写入的C根据用户的需求,由用户R0M中的信息是( )。A由计算机制造厂预先写入的B在系统安装时写入的C根据用户的需求,由用户随时写入的D由程序临时存入的正确答案:A29. 无符号数在前面加零扩展,数值不变有符号数前面进行符号扩展,位数加长一位、数值增加一倍。

11、( )A、错误B、正确参考答案:A30. MOVS前可添加的前缀为( )。A、REPE/REPZB、REPNE/REPNZC、REPD、无参考答案:C31. 当中断发生后,进入中断处理的程序属于( )。A用户程序BOS程序C可能是用户程序,也可能是OS当中断发生后,进入中断处理的程序属于( )。A用户程序BOS程序C可能是用户程序,也可能是OS程序D单独的程序,既不是用户程序,也不是OS程序正确答案:B操作系统在发生中断的时候,由其中断处理程序负责分析中断源并转到相应的处理程序。32. 8086CPU用( )信号的下降沿在T1结束时将地址信息锁存在地址锁存器中。A、RDB、RESTC、ALED

12、、READY参考答案:C33. 8255的A口工作在方式1输入时,其中断允许控制位INTE的开/关是通过对的按位置位/复位操作完成的( )。8255的A口工作在方式1输入时,其中断允许控制位INTE的开/关是通过对的按位置位/复位操作完成的( )。A、PC0B、PC2C、PC4D、PC6正确答案:C34. 8253芯片由数据总线缓冲存储器、读/写控制电路、控制字寄存器及3个计数通道组成。( )A.错误B.正确参考答案:B35. 若用6264SRAM芯片(8K8位)组成128KB的存储器系统,需要( )片6264芯片。A.16B.24C.32D.64参考答案:A36. 8086CPU中BIU和E

13、U是互相独立、互相配合并行同步工作的,目的在于提高CPU的工作效率。( )8086CPU中BIU和EU是互相独立、互相配合并行同步工作的,目的在于提高CPU的工作效率。()正确37. 设有如下文法G(S是G的开始符号): G:SA*BB A*B* BA (1)求文法G的LR(1)初始项目设有如下文法G(S是G的开始符号): G:SA*BB A*B* BA (1)求文法G的LR(1)初始项目集I0,并求出GO(I0,*)。 (2)试判断文法G是四类LR文法的哪一类。正确答案:(1)首先对文法进行拓广:rn SS SA*B SB A*B A* BArn 文法G的LR(1)初始项目集I0SSSA*BS.BB.Arn A.*BA.*rn GO(I0*)A*.BA*.B.AA.*BA.*)rn (2)由(1)可知项目集GO(I0*)中存在“移进一归约”冲突因此该文法不是LR(0)文法。根据SLR(1)方法求解:rn FOLLOW(A)*#)rn 且rn FOLLOW(A)*)rn 表明使用SLR(1)方法无法解决“移进一归约”冲突故该文法不是SLR(1)文法。rn 文法的LR(1)项目集规范族如图527所示。rnrn 考察该文法的LR(1)项目集规范族项目集I2中存在“移进一归约”冲突故该文法为非四类LR文法。首先对文法进行拓广:SSSA*BS

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 高等教育 > 其它相关文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号